Migraines post IVF

0 replies

madeyemoody · 14/02/2023 11:13

My wife (36) has three IVF rounds (unsuccessful Confused) and during IVF had the first ever migraine of her life. The debilitating ones where she couldn't eat or drink, vomiting and needed a pitch black room.

The fertility doc said it was unfortunately not too uncommon because of the hormones. These have continued now since stopping all meds over a year ago. Once a month. PMS migraines we have worked out. The GP has prescribed sumatriptan which works very well and relieves the worst of it. But it's still taking my wife out of work for 2 days a month. The GP has refused to refer to neuro because the sumatriptan works to well that this is just a condition my wife has now and she is now a "migraine sufferer"

Is this right?? How can my wife be left to miss work for 2 days every month? I'm very naive to things like this so it might be normal practice I just thought a little more investigation would be done since they started later in life?
